the Flexible City

 

 

Considering that actual modifications in social and economic contexts take place in hurry motion, is essential an immediate adaptation to the civitas (a company who lives in urbs) and  the polis (city government and institutional).

It is necessary that the material component of the city must adapt to the needs of the citiziens and, as a consequence, to think about cities and territories as flexible environments.

The problem is:  can the liquid society shape the structure and form of the city?

 

Flexibility is the adaptation to the social and economic conditions, the ability of the city to be efficient in a short time according to the demands of the context.
